Having A Hard Time Forgiving? | 3 Tips For Forgiveness
SponsoredCheating is never okay, but understanding the reasons why could help you forgive t…Take The Quiz · Is He Cheating? · Find Out
Service catalog: Relationship Advice, Infidelity Therapy, Private InvestigationYou Deserve to Be Happy | 100% Online Therapy
SponsoredPersonalized Anger Management Therapy. Our Quiz Helps Match You to the Right …Therapy On Your Schedule · Get Happy, Start Therapy
Types: Chat Counseling, Text Counseling, Email Counseling, Phone CounselingBetterHelp was a positive and professional experience. – WSJ